According to Yonhap News,

The 4th Busan International Film Festival for Women's Rights is to be held at Lotte Cinema Friday. The film festival is designed to let the public know the stark reality of violence against women and reflect upon human right issues under the slogan of "Find the Path within Movie."

"The first movie to be showed during the festival is a legal documentary film titled "Crime After Crime," directed by Yoav Potash.

Another movie titled "Power and Control: Domestic Violence in America," produced by Peter Cohn, will also be unveiled. The movie features a mother of three daughters who tries to escape from domestic violence.

A campaign sending postcards to female victims of domestic violence will also be held on the sidelines of the film festival.
